Regarding paging: I don't think a total row at a page level would be really 
useful for me. Pages are often introduced for practical reasons, because the 
table is too big for the webpage. In that case the number of lines displayed 
on a page is driven by the amount of space allocated for displaying the 
table, which makes totals for the lines appearing on each page quite 
irrelevant. Obviously this is my own business requirement, someone else 
might find it very useful... In an ideal world we would have the on/off 
option for page and table total rows ;-) .
